New Delhi: In a move to provide relief to flyers, Air India has announced that all its tickets, irrespective of the date of purchase, will be valid till December 31, 2021.
As part of its new waiver policy, Air India said in a circular that the offer will be applicable for domestic as well as international flights that have been booked between March 15 and August 24, 2020.
Flyers will be able to change the flight, date, or route of their respective flights without paying any extra money till August 24. The journey has to be completed by the end of next year.
If anyone wants to change his/her route, he/she can to do so by adjusting value of the existing ticket against the new fare. There will be no charge for re-issuance of the ticket, but if the fare of new ticket is lower than the existing ticket fare, the balance won’t be refunded.
Air India hopes that this will help reduce stress and anxiety of flyers amid the COVID-19 pandemic.
It may be recalled that the Supreme Court had observed last week: “Why should credit being issued by the airlines be limited to a short period or for the same route?”
